Merge pull request 'master' (#1) from master into main
Reviewed-on: https://timerix.ddns.net:3322/Timerix/cbuild-c/pulls/1
This commit is contained in:
commit
d6eb651410
0
detect_arch.sh
Normal file → Executable file
0
detect_arch.sh
Normal file → Executable file
0
detect_os.sh
Normal file → Executable file
0
detect_os.sh
Normal file → Executable file
2
kerep/build.sh
Normal file → Executable file
2
kerep/build.sh
Normal file → Executable file
@ -3,7 +3,7 @@ set -eo pipefail
|
||||
|
||||
CMP="gcc"
|
||||
WARN="-std=c11 -Wall -Wno-discarded-qualifiers -Wno-unused-parameter"
|
||||
ARGS="-O2 -flto=auto -fpic -fdata-sections -ffunction-sections"
|
||||
ARGS="-O2"
|
||||
SRC="$(find src -name '*.c')"
|
||||
|
||||
OS=$(../detect_os.sh)
|
||||
|
||||
@ -1,4 +1,4 @@
|
||||
#include "process.h"
|
||||
#include "Process.h"
|
||||
|
||||
#ifndef USE_WINDOWS_PROCESS_API
|
||||
|
||||
@ -6,7 +6,7 @@
|
||||
#include <unistd.h>
|
||||
#include <sys/wait.h>
|
||||
#include <errno.h>
|
||||
extern int kill (__pid_t __pid, int __sig) __THROW;
|
||||
extern int kill (__pid_t __pid, int __sig);
|
||||
extern void * memset(void * __dst, int __val, size_t __n);
|
||||
|
||||
#define throw_if_negative(expr) if(expr < 0) throw(cptr_concat(#expr " exited with error ", toString_i64(errno)));
|
||||
@ -96,4 +96,4 @@ i32 PipeHandle_read(PipeHandle pipe, char* buf, i32 bufsize){
|
||||
return read(pipe, buf, bufsize);
|
||||
}
|
||||
|
||||
#endif
|
||||
#endif
|
||||
|
||||
@ -1,4 +1,4 @@
|
||||
#include "process.h"
|
||||
#include "Process.h"
|
||||
|
||||
#ifdef USE_WINDOWS_PROCESS_API
|
||||
#include <windows.h>
|
||||
@ -138,4 +138,4 @@ i32 PipeHandle_read(PipeHandle pipe, char* buf, i32 bufsize){
|
||||
return bytesRead;
|
||||
}
|
||||
|
||||
#endif
|
||||
#endif
|
||||
|
||||
Loading…
Reference in New Issue
Block a user